Unpacking the AlkaTech StellarBook 14: Is This the Best Laptop for Students?

First impressions matter, and the StellarBook 14 makes a strong one. Out of the box, its sleek, minimalist aluminum chassis immediately signals a premium experience without shouting for attention. Weighing in at a mere 1.2 kg (2.65 lbs) and with a profile thinner than most textbooks, it instantly qualifies as a top contender for a portable laptop for college. This isn’t just a machine you can carry; it’s a machine you’ll barely notice in your backpack, which is a huge win for students constantly moving between classes, dorms, and libraries.

The build quality feels robust, defying its lightweight design. There’s minimal flex in the lid or keyboard deck, suggesting it can withstand the rigors of daily student life – accidental bumps in crowded hallways included. The hinge is smooth yet firm, allowing for easy one-handed opening and holding the screen steady at any angle. Design Language and Port Selection

The StellarBook 14 adopts a clean, professional aesthetic that wouldn’t look out of place in a boardroom, let alone a lecture hall. The bezels around the display are commendably thin, maximizing screen real estate and contributing to its modern look. But beyond aesthetics, a student laptop needs functionality, and AlkaTech hasn’t skimped on ports.

  • 2x USB-C (USB 4.0 with Power Delivery & DisplayPort): Versatile for charging, external displays, and high-speed data transfer.
  • 2x USB-A 3.2 Gen 2: Essential for older peripherals, flash drives, and external mice.
  • HDMI 2.1: For connecting to projectors in presentations or external monitors for extended workspaces.
  • microSD Card Reader: Convenient for photographers or those needing quick data transfer from phones/cameras.
  • 3.5mm Audio Jack: Still indispensable for wired headphones.

This comprehensive port selection means you won’t be constantly fumbling for dongles, a common frustration with many ultra-thin laptops today. Performance and Portability: Why the AlkaTech StellarBook 14 Excels for Students

Beneath its elegant exterior, the StellarBook 14 packs a punch that belies its slim profile. Our review unit came equipped with the AMD Ryzen 7 7730U processor, 16GB of LPDDR5 RAM, and a speedy 512GB NVMe SSD. This configuration is more than capable of handling the diverse workloads students face daily, from extensive research with dozens of browser tabs open to complex data analysis or even light video editing.

Key Performance Specs:
Processor: AMD Ryzen 7 7730U
RAM: 16GB LPDDR5 (6400MHz)
Storage: 512GB NVMe PCIe Gen 4 SSD
Graphics: AMD Radeon Graphics
Operating System: Windows 11 Home

In our benchmark tests, the Ryzen 7 7730U proved its mettle. It scored impressively in multi-core performance tests, indicating excellent capability for multitasking and running demanding applications concurrently. Even when pushing it with a heavy load – think multiple Word documents, a PowerPoint presentation, a few research papers in PDF, Spotify streaming, and 20+ Chrome tabs – the StellarBook 14 remained responsive and cool. Battery Life: The Marathon Runner

Perhaps one of the most critical features for any student laptop is battery life. Nobody wants to be tethered to a power outlet in a crowded lecture hall or during a study group in a cafe. The StellarBook 14 truly shines here, thanks to its efficient AMD processor and a generous 60Wh battery. In our AlkaTech battery rundown test, which simulates typical student usage (web browsing, document editing, video playback at 150 nits brightness), the StellarBook 14 consistently delivered over 14 hours of use on a single charge.

This outstanding endurance means you can easily get through a full day of classes, meetings, and study sessions without needing to carry your charger. Beyond the Specs: Display, Keyboard, and Connectivity

A great student laptop isn’t just about raw power; it’s about the entire user experience. The StellarBook 14’s 14-inch IPS display with a 1920×1200 resolution and a modern 16:10 aspect ratio is a joy to behold. The extra vertical space provided by the 16:10 ratio is surprisingly beneficial for productivity, allowing you to see more of your documents or web pages without endless scrolling. Colors are vibrant, viewing angles are wide, and the 300 nits of brightness are sufficient for most indoor environments, even well-lit classrooms.

The display is also equipped with an anti-glare coating, which is a lifesaver when working near windows or under harsh overhead lighting. While not a 4K panel, the Full HD+ resolution is perfectly sharp at this size, ensuring text is crisp and images are clear. Typing Experience and Webcam Quality

For students, the keyboard is their primary interface with the digital world. The StellarBook 14 features a comfortable, backlit keyboard with well-spaced keys and a satisfying 1.4mm of key travel. Typing for extended periods felt effortless, with a tactile feedback that prevented fatigue. The precision glass trackpad is equally impressive, offering smooth, accurate tracking and supporting Windows Precision drivers for fluid multi-touch gestures. This combination makes navigating documents and applications a breeze.

In an age of hybrid learning and online presentations, a good webcam is no longer a luxury but a necessity. The StellarBook 14 includes a 1080p Full HD webcam, a significant upgrade from the often-mediocre 720p cameras found on many competitors. Its image quality is sharp and clear, even in moderately low light, making you look professional and engaged during video calls, online classes, and virtual study groups. The integrated dual-array microphones also do a decent job of picking up your voice clearly, minimizing background noise.

Frequently Asked Questions about Student Laptops

❓ Frequently Asked Questions

What specifications are most important for a student laptop?

For students, prioritize a fast processor (e.g., Intel Core i5/i7 or AMD Ryzen 5/7), at least 8GB (preferably 16GB) of RAM for multitasking, and a 256GB or larger SSD for quick boot times and application loading. Good battery life and portability are also crucial.

How much should I expect to spend on the best laptop for students?

A good student laptop typically ranges from $700 to $1200. While cheaper options exist, they often involve compromises in performance or build quality. Higher-end models for specific fields like engineering might exceed this range.

Is a 13-inch or 15-inch laptop better for students?

A 13-inch or 14-inch laptop generally offers the best balance of portability and screen real estate for students, making it easier to carry around campus. A 15-inch model might be preferred if you primarily use it at a desk and need a larger screen for design work or extensive multitasking.

What’s the ideal battery life for a student laptop?

Aim for a laptop that offers at least 8-10 hours of real-world battery life. This ensures you can get through a full day of classes and study sessions without needing to constantly search for a power outlet.

Are ‘student laptop deals’ worth waiting for?

Absolutely. Many manufacturers and retailers offer significant discounts, bundles, or freebies (like software or accessories) during back-to-school periods, Black Friday, or student-specific promotions. These deals can save you a substantial amount of money.
